A stakeholder consultation was organised by ICRIER on September 3, 2019 at New Delhi to discuss the study on “The Role of Standards in Diffusion of Emerging Technologies: Internet of Things (IoT)”, commissioned by the Department of Science and Industrial Research (DSIR), Government of India. To set the context and present the preliminary findings of the study, a presentation was made by Mansi Kedia, Fellow, ICRIER, which provided a concise overview of the evolution of the IoT ecosystem (India and globally), the importance of standardisation and the role of standards development organisations (SDOs). The subsequent discussion focussed on the importance of standardisation and the role of SDOs and the challenges related to the adoption and implementation of standards in India. The participants noted that India’s current contribution to the standards ecosystem has largely come from Indian counterparts of foreign corporates. Alternatively, global standards were adopted, which did not necessarily cater to the needs of the Indian IoT ecosystem. There was consensus on the need to enhance India’s role by increasing participation and contributing more actively to the global standards ecosystem. This will help India develop innovative methods concepts which could be cornerstones for the emerging ‘smart’ industries and ‘smart’ solutions.
